"Masche" meaning in German

See Masche in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/ˈmaʃə/ Audio: De-Masche.ogg
Rhymes: -aʃə Etymology: From Middle High German masche, from Old High German maska, from a Proto-West Germanic *maskā. Cognate with Old Saxon maska. More at mesh.   1. (knitting, crocheting) stitch Tags: feminine Categories (topical): Knitting

  2. hole (in a net) Tags: feminine

  3. link (in chainmail) Tags: feminine

Rhymes: -aʃə Etymology: Probably from the older meaning of “safety net, sling used for hunting”. Head templates: {{de-noun|f.sg}} Masche f (genitive Masche, no plural) Inflection templates: {{de-ndecl|f.sg}}
  1. (colloquial) trick, scam, shtick Tags: colloquial, feminine, no-plural
